Industrial Applications
✔Metal Fabrication & Welding: Essential for pre-weld cleaning and post-weld slag removal. The twist knot brush aggressively cleans weld seams.
✔Marine & Offshore Maintenance: Use our Stainless Steel (INOX) brushes to remove corrosion from aluminum or stainless parts without ferrous contamination.
✔Automotive Restoration: Perfect for stripping rust and undercoatings from the chassis without excessively removing the base metal.
✔Construction: Rapidly prepares structural steel by removing mill scale and old paint.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: What is the difference between Crimped (Wave) and Twist Knot brushes?
Crimped brushes are flexible and less aggressive, making them ideal for surface finishing, light rust, and paint removal on thin metals. Twist Knot brushes are rigid and highly aggressive, designed for heavy-duty tasks such as weld slag and severe corrosion removal.
Q: Can I use a carbon steel brush on stainless steel?
No. You must always use a Stainless Steel (INOX) wire brush on stainless parts. Using carbon steel will leave iron particles that cause "after-rust" on the surface.

Fuji products are manufactured following strict Japanese standard process requirements. Every wheel is engineered to meet or exceed JIS (Japanese Industrial Standards), such as JIS R 6242 and B 4051. Our core engineering logic prioritizes maximum operator protection by maintaining safety factors and burst speed capabilities that often surpass the highest industry benchmarks.
Standard Region
Safety Factor (Burst Multiplier)
Safety Logic & Benchmark
FUJI (High Precision)
> 2.0x
Engineered to exceed JIS requirements for maximum reliability.
Japan (JIS R 6242)
2.0x
Extreme Safety: A wheel rated at 80m/s must withstand a 160m/s burst test.
Europe (EN 12413)
$1.73x
Risk Balanced: Provides high safety redundancy for most industrial apps.
USA (ANSI B7.1)
1.5x
Efficiency Focused: Relies on machine guarding and operational procedures.
1.RPM Compliance: Never exceed the maximum R.P.M. specified on the wheel. Using the sides of the wheels for grinding is strictly prohibited, as it compromises the structural integrity of the abrasive bond.
2.Mandatory Idling: Allow the tool to idle for one minute before beginning work. If a new wheel has been mounted, an idle run of three minutes is required to ensure dynamic stability.
3.Workpiece Stability: All materials must be securely fastened. Improperly secured workpieces can lead to vibration, wheel binding, and unsafe kickback forces.
4.Arbor Hole Integrity: Do not modify or enlarge the metal center of the arbor hole. A proper fit is critical; a mismatched arbor causes eccentric rotation and dangerous vibration levels.
5.PPE Requirements: Industrial-grade face and eye protection are mandatory at all times. Ensure all protective gear meets local safety compliance standards.
6.Guard Protection: Protection guards are designed to contain fragments in the unlikely event of a wheel failure. Never operate tools or machinery with guards removed.

Professional Export & Maintenance Insight
When deploying Fuji high-performance tools in overseas markets, ensure that the regional power grid frequency and voltage match the tool specifications. To maintain the superior burst speed safety of Fuji wheels, store abrasives in a dry, temperate environment. Humidity can degrade the resin bond, potentially lowering the wheel’s resistance to centrifugal forces.
